NOLA MusiCon to Highlight Music Industry in New Orleans

The upcoming NOLA MusiCon, scheduled from Tuesday, October 24 to Friday, October 27, is garnering attention from music enthusiasts, industry professionals, and aspiring artists. This music industry conference will take place at the Royal Sonesta Hotel.

NOLA MusiCon is home to one of the world’s most diverse and lively music communities. It provides attendees with a comprehensive program spanning three and a half days, featuring panels, interviews, brand demos, mentor sessions, live performances from local talents, and numerous networking opportunities.

The conference program is designed to cover various aspects of a music career, from the initial creative spark to production, distribution, and navigating the music industry. Attendees can explore topics such as Music Creation, Production, Recording, Live Performance, Music Supervision, PR, Publishing, Revenue Streams, Activism, and Music Tech.

The event aims to fulfill a dual objective: educate and empower artists and music professionals while emphasizing New Orleans as a fertile ground for growth in the music business. While New Orleans is renowned for its live music scene, NOLA MusiCon spotlights its potential as a hub for music industry professionals.

This year’s speakers include notable figures like music attorney Tim Kappel, Music Manager Reid Martin, Music Supervisor Sarah Bromberg, Music Entrepreneur Nate Cameron, and Jonathan McHugh, the Chair of Music Industry Studies at Loyola University.
